Is it possible to make lists within my cellar?

I would like to have a list of wines I have designated for immediate drinking, a list for wines that I should use on a given occasion (and remember not to drink it before) etc.

When the wine is drunk it should clearly disappear from said list.

Is that possible?

You can use the Tagged List functionality. Click on My Wish List at the top and then create as many new lists as you need. It will not automatically be deleted from the list when you drink it. If you use the side panel, just delete it from the tagged list before you remove it from your inventory.
